Summary We are seeking a Coding Manager to join our dynamic team at UMC. In this role, you will Manage the daily operations and delivery of physician office and professional fee coding services with adherence to established coding guidelines; responsible for managing the coordination of accurate and compliant Professional Services coding of pertinent medical information; ensures accurate assignment of codes and compliance with regulatory requirements. Assists in determining strategic priorities and planning for unit operations and participates in the audit projects and provides education to the Professional Services coding team based on the audit findings. Responsibilities Manage and supervise the coding team to ensure accurate and timely coding of medical records. Develop and implement coding policies and procedures in compliance with regulatory standards. Conduct regular audits to ensure coding accuracy and provide feedback for improvement. Collaborate with clinical staff to clarify documentation requirements and enhance coding practices. Provide training and support to coding staff on coding guidelines and software updates. Monitor key performance indicators related to coding efficiency and accuracy. Requirements Equivalent to a bachelor's degree in health information management or a related field. Five (5) years of coding/auditing experience in an acute care setting, three (3) years of which were in a supervisory/management role. Certified Professional Coder (CPC); or, multiple specialty-specific coding certifications from the American Academy of Professional Coders (AAPC); or, Certified Coding Specialist, Physician-based (CCS-P); or, Certified Coding Specialist (CCS), Registered Health Information Technician (RHIT); or, Registered Health Information Administrator (RHIA) issued from the American Health Information Management Association (AHIMA) Strong knowledge of ICD-10, CPT, and HCPCS coding systems.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ills. Ability to analyze data and implement process improvements.
